Growing Importance of Static-Free Films in Packaging Market

Static-free films are increasingly becoming a critical component in the packaging market due to their ability to prevent the buildup of static electricity. This feature is particularly important when packaging sensitive electronic components, as static electricity can damage or interfere with the proper functioning of these items. By utilizing static-free films, manufacturers can ensure that their products are well-protected during storage and transportation, reducing the risk of costly damages.

Moreover, static-free films also play a key role in enhancing the overall presentation of packaged goods. By eliminating static cling, these films help maintain the quality and appearance of products, creating a more appealing visual experience for consumers. As the packaging market continues to prioritize aesthetics and quality, the demand for static-free films is expected to rise, further underscoring their growing importance in today's market landscape.

Key Features of Static-Free Films for Packaging Applications

Static-free films are designed specifically to address the issue of static electricity in packaging applications. One key feature of static-free films is their ability to reduce static build-up, which can attract dust, debris, and other contaminants, impacting the overall appearance and quality of the packaged product. By minimizing static electricity, these films help maintain the cleanliness and integrity of the packaged goods throughout the supply chain, ensuring customer satisfaction and brand reputation.

In addition to static control, static-free films also offer excellent clarity and transparency, allowing for optimal visibility of the packaged product. This feature is particularly important for industries where product visibility is essential for marketing and consumer appeal. Moreover, these films provide exceptional sealing properties, ensuring the contents remain secure and protected from external elements such as moisture, light, and air. Ultimately, the key features of static-free films make them a preferred choice for companies looking to enhance the presentation, protection, and quality of their packaged products.

Advantages of Using Static-Free Films in Packaging Market

Static-free films offer numerous advantages in the packaging market. Firstly, these films help enhance the overall product presentation by reducing static cling, which can attract dust and other particles, leading to a more visually appealing end product. Additionally, the anti-static properties of these films contribute to improved product safety by minimizing the risk of electrical discharge, especially in electronic components or sensitive equipment packaging.

Moreover, static-free films contribute to operational efficiency during the packaging process. By reducing static electricity, these films facilitate a smoother handling and packaging experience, resulting in less downtime and improved productivity. This is particularly beneficial in high-speed packaging lines where static-related issues can lead to bottlenecks and disruptions in the production process.

Challenges Faced by Manufacturers in the Static-Free Film Market

Manufacturers in the static-free film market encounter various challenges that can hinder the production and distribution of these specialized films. One of the primary obstacles is the high cost associated with developing and manufacturing static-free films. The materials and technologies required to produce such films are often more expensive compared to traditional packaging films, leading to increased production costs for manufacturers.

Additionally, maintaining consistent quality and performance standards poses a challenge for manufacturers in the static-free film market. Variations in the electrical properties of the films, such as surface resistivity and charge decay time, can impact the effectiveness of the static-free features. Ensuring that each batch of static-free film meets the required specifications and performance criteria can be a demanding task, requiring rigorous quality control measures and testing protocols.

Innovations and Technological Advancements in Static-Free Film Production

In recent years, the production of static-free films for packaging applications has witnessed remarkable advancements in technology. One significant innovation is the development of specialized coating techniques that enhance the antistatic properties of the films. These advanced coatings are designed to effectively prevent the build-up of static charges, ensuring the safe and efficient packaging of sensitive electronic components, food products, and various industrial goods.

Moreover, the integration of nano-materials in static-free film production has revolutionized the market by providing superior antistatic performance and durability. Nano-engineered additives are now being incorporated into film formulations to offer enhanced static dissipation properties without compromising the physical and mechanical characteristics of the packaging material. This breakthrough in nanotechnology has paved the way for the development of next-generation static-free films that meet the evolving needs of the packaging market in terms of performance, sustainability, and product protection.

Key Players and Competitors in the Static-Free Film Market

The market for static-free films in packaging is highly competitive, with several key players and competitors vying for market share. Companies such as 3M Company, DuPont de Nemours, Inc., and Toray Plastics (America), Inc. are notable players in the static-free film market due to their strong product portfolios and global presence. These companies have been at the forefront of innovation, constantly introducing new products and technologies to meet the evolving needs of the packaging market.

In addition to the key players, there are a number of smaller competitors in the static-free film market that are carving out their own niche. Companies like SABIC, Innovia Films, and Uflex Ltd. are gaining traction by offering specialized solutions and customized products to cater to specific customer requirements. These competitors often focus on niche segments or geographical regions to differentiate themselves from the larger players in the market.
